Description

"Where does the current explosion in literary theory come from? What earlier theoretical movements does it grow out of, bounce off, react against?" "This introductory history homes in on the essential principles governing the major movements in literary theory, unfolding a comprehensive 'story' with all its jumps and swings and switches.". "In this volume, the author looks behind particular critical judgements and interpretations in order to present a clear explanation of the core underlying positions. He explains the internal rationale of each position, together with its derivation and repercussions. At the same time, he shows how 'literary theory' has taken on very different roles in different periods. He relates these different roles to particular socio-political settings, institutional contexts and creative practices."--BOOK JACKET.
